Formations MS10054 - SQL Server 2008 Ecrire des requêtes Transac SQL avec SQL Server 2008

Formation DATASTAGE

Toutes les formations Datastage sont disponibles chez Nativo.

Lire la suite ...

Intra-entreprise :
Formation personnalisée dans vos locaux.

Inter-entreprise :
Formation dans nos locaux.


Formation MS10054 - SQL Server 2008 Ecrire des requêtes Transac SQL avec SQL Server 2008

Durée : 3 jours
Prix HT : 1 350 €
Lieu : Paris (La Défense)
Ref : MS10054


Prochaines sessions :
14 mai 2012 | 30 mai 2012 | 15 juin 2012 | 2 juillet 2012 | 3 septembre 2012 |
22 octobre 2012 | 29 octobre 2012 | 3 décembre 2012 | Egalement disponible en Intra : Tarif au 01 46 20 18 40.
 Télécharger le plan de cours  Envoyer à un ami  Imprimer

Objectifs de la formation

A la fin de cette formation, les participants auront les compétences techniques nécessaires pour écrire des requêtes basiques pour Microsoft SQL Server 2008.

- Effectuer des requêtes de base
- Grouper et agréger des données
- Requêter des données issues de plusieurs tables
- Travailler avec des sous-requêtes
- Modifier les données
- Faire des requêtes sur des métadonnées, XML et des index full-text
- Utiliser les objets de programmation pour récupérer des données
- Créer des objets de programmation
- Utiliser les requêtes avancées

Publics

Ce cours est destiné aux professionnels de l'informatique souhaitant apprendre à écrire des requêtes pour SQL Server 2008. Il n'est pas nécessaire de connaître SQL Server.

Pré-requis pour suivre cette formation SQL Server 2008

Les participants doivent posséder les connaissances suivantes :
1.Une compréhension de base des concepts de bases de données relationnelles, notamment :
- La conception logique et physique d'une base de données
- Comment sont stockées les données dans les tables (lignes et colonnes).
- Concepts d'intégrité des données
- Les relations entre les tables et colonnes (clés primaires et étrangères, cardinalités)
2.Connaissances de base du système d'exploitation Microsoft Windows et de ses principales fonctionnalités.

Contenu de la formation SQL Server 2008 :

1- Introduction au Transact-SQL
Language T-SQL
Les types
La syntaxe
Utiliser l'aide en ligne

2 - Utilisation des outils T-SQL
L'analyseur de requêtes SQL
Utilitaire osql
Exécution d'instructions Transact-SQL
Créer et executer un script T-SQL

3 - Extraction de données
Extraction de données à l'aide de l'instruction SELECTs
Filtrage des données
Mise en forme des ensembles de résultats
Traitement des requêtes
Remarques sur les performances

4 - Regroupement et synthèse de données
Énumération des n premières (TOP) valeurs
Utiliser les fonctions d'agrégation
Présentation de la clause GROUP BY
Génération de valeurs d'agrégation dans des ensembles de résultats
Utilisation des clauses COMPUTE et COMPUTE BY

5 - Jointure de tables
Utilisation d'alias pour les noms de tables
Combinaison de données provenant de plusieurs tables
Combinaison d'ensembles de résultats

6 - Utilisation de sous-requêtes
Présentation des sous-requêtes
Utilisation d'une sous-requête en tant que table dérivée
Utilisation d'une sous-requête en tant qu'expression
Utilisation d'une sous-requête pour corréler des données
Utilisation des clauses EXISTS et NOT EXISTS

7 - Modification des données
Utilisation de transactions
Insertion de données
Suppression de données
Mise à jour de données
Remarques sur les performances

8: extensions T-SQL
OUTER APPLY et CROSS APPLY
PIVOT and UNPIVOT
TRY/CATCH

9 - Afficher le contenu des objets
Introduction aux vues
Avantages des vues
Création des vues
Introduction aux procédures stockées
Introduction aux déclencheurs
Introduction aux fonctions définies par l'utilisateur